Jane's Escape From Hell
Jane (not her real name) is a successful entrepreneur from London in her mid-30's. For the past 15 years, she ran multiple entertainment businesses from talent agencies to nightclub entertainment and staffing agencies.
Although she didn't know anyone else at the retreat, she quickly made friends and connected with the group due to her pleasant, humorous, and friendly attitude.
From her dress, it was clear she's financially successful from her jewelry, luxury watch, and designer clothing.
Jane's reason for being at the retreat, in her own words, was, "because I have a lot of trauma to release".
None of us had any idea of the level of trauma she was talking about until she shared her first night's ayahuasca experience in the morning sharing session...
"At first, I could see all these complex cities with metal and concrete everywhere. Some of them looked like Earth, others looked like alien cities.
As each city was shown to me, eventually I saw that they all got taken over by nature.
Grass would creep through a crack in the concrete, vines would climb up skyscrapers and weaken it.
Eventually, nature reclaimed everything in every one of these cities.
I know what the message is for me.
I've been living my life very materialistically, and Mother Aya was showing me that it will all be taken away.
I, and perhaps we as a species, need to live closer to nature. I feel less attached to these materialistic things now."
But then it got dark...
"I could hear a loud screeching sound coming into my left ear.
I was trying to ignore it while I was having the experience, but it was so loud and annoying that eventually, I opened my eyes and turned around to see what it was.
That's when I saw this huge machine whirring and screeching right next to me.
I noticed two tubes coming out of the machine, and they were attached to my side. It was clear that it was sucking something out of me.
Life force?
I pulled out the tubes and then saw these two demon-looking figures with long black coats with hoods staring at me.
It looked like they were operating the machine. They were hideous.
I started to get up from the table, and they scurried out of the room.
Then I woke up."
Jane then went on to share that she's been in a dark place emotionally and in life for a very long time.
In fact, the motivation to come to this retreat was that she was in a physically abusive relationship which ended up with the guy she was with beating her up.
He then proceeded to stab himself in front of her and called the police, accusing her of doing it.
Luckily, the police saw right through the lies, and that man is now in jail.
Obviously, that was a scarring experience for Jane.
Unfortunately, she had been on the receiving end of physical abuse from men since she was a little girl.
Her step-father doled out so much physical abuse to her as a child that if the authorities found out, he would be in jail for life.
Since that scarring as a child, she came to expect the abuse and has had it play over and over again, countless times with men throughout her life.
She observed that she's been carrying a lot of shame and guilt throughout her life around these experiences.

In the Kali Santarana Upanishads, an ancient Hindu text, it is said that one can shake off the evil effects of the Kali (darkness and ignorance, otherwise known as low vibration energy) by chanting the Hare Krishna mantra:
Hare Rama Hare Rama, Rama Rama Hare Hare, Hare Krishna Hare Krishna, Krishna Krishna Hare Hare.
By repeating these sacred names of the Divine, it is believed that a powerful spiritual vibration is invoked, purifying one's energy field and creating a shield of protection against negative influences and entities.
